Olympic gold medallist could face up to 10 years in jail after vape cartridges containing hashish oil were found in her luggage

US basketball player Brittney Griner, who was detained at Moscow's Sheremetyevo airport and later charged with illegal possession of cannabis, looks on inside a defendants' cage before a court hearing in Khimki outside Moscow on August 2 2022. Picture: REUTERS/EVGENIA NOVOZHENINA

She has pleaded guilty to the drugs charges against her but has denied that she intended to break Russian law. She faces up to 10 years in prison. Blagovolina said Griner heard that Washington had made what secretary of state Antony Blinken called a “substantial offer” to Moscow to release American citizens held in Russia.

Griner, who appeared in Khimki district court outside Moscow in a plain khaki T-shirt and round-rimmed glasses, was both focused and nervous as her trial approaches its end, her lawyer said.
